Easy to walk right out the door to do the beautiful Ness of Hillswick walk (highly recommend)! There is also a wildlife sanctuary and we were able to see some adorable baby seals. Doing anything else in the area is quite difficult without a car so I do recommend having one if possible or else plan very carefully (we were lucky enough to get someone from the hotel to drive us to Eshaness and our cab picked us up from there instead of from the hotel as originally planned).

On the main bus route. Beautiful views of the ocean. Comfortable bed, good shower, Friendly staff. All meals available at the hotel. Good food.Particularly grateful to Andrea for her help and local knowledge. Some local walks close by.
To really see Shetland we needed to hire a car. The hotel is about an hour and a quarter away from the airport and the bus service is limited, although there is a main hub in Lerwick.
